Job Title: Underwriting Analyst, Asset Management

The Amherst Group Limited is a leading real estate investment and advisory firm that is revolutionizing the way U.S. real estate is priced, managed, and financed. We are seeking an Underwriting Analyst to join our Asset Management team in Austin, TX.

Job Summary:

The Underwriting Analyst will be responsible for underwriting and locating investment opportunities, tracking assets through various phases of the deal lifecycle, and constructing detailed presentations to report on market trends and strategies for senior management. The successful candidate will have a strong academic background in finance, real estate, or a related field, and will be proficient in Microsoft Excel and PowerPoint.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Underwrite and locate investment opportunities using market comparables to determine accurate rent, value, and initial bid price for a single-family asset
  • Centrally participate in the acquisition of single-family homes by tracking the asset through various phases of the deal lifecycle
  • Construct detailed and holistic presentations to report on market trends and strategies for senior management to inform investment strategies across the organization
  • Underwrite and monitor the rental market to analyze existing portfolio performance and help with revenue management strategies for various regions across Amherst's 45,000+ homes portfolio
  • Collaborate and drive strategic initiatives across Amherst's operating partners to improve margins and returns
Requirements:
  • Bachelor's degree required, specialty focus in Real Estate or Finance a plus
  • 0-2 years of relevant experience in underwriting, brokerage, or other real estate related disciplines
  • Fluent in Microsoft Excel and PowerPoint, knowledge of SQL and Python a plus
  • Strong academic background with focus in finance, real estate, accounting, or math preferred
  • Top-ranked performer with a track record of success (academic, professional)
  • Strong verbal and written skills to communicate effectively with internal and external professionals
  • Candidate should be extremely detail-oriented and organized with a proven ability to work well in a high-intensity environment to complete tasks quickly and effectively
  • Ability to prioritize multiple deadlines while delivering a high-quality product under tight time constraints
